Joanne (Labuda) Kunkel Georges

Newburyport – Joanne Kunkel Georges, 70, passed away peacefully at her home

on Plum Island in Newburyport December 28, 2020 surrounded by her loving

family.

Born in Ludlow and raised in Indian Orchard, MA, she was the daughter of the late

Mitchell and Anne (Jez) Labuda. She was a graduate of Cathedral High School in

Springfield and obtained her Bachelor’s Degree from Boston University. Joanne

had a corporate career with Budget Rent A Car managing operations at Logan

Airport and moved on to national management, later in life she worked as a

corporate consultant. She had a passion for the water and loved spending time

boating and sailing with her husband Paul. Joanne enjoyed gardening, reading and

taking long walks with her dog, Graci. Her favorite thing was spending time with

her grandchildren, whom she absolutely adored.

 

Joanne is survived by her husband, Paul Georges of Newburyport; her children,

Ross Kunkel, Kristi Reed and Kerri Kunkel; grandchildren Penelope and Sebastian

Kunkel; brothers Chuck Labuda and Dan Labuda. Funeral services at this time will be private.

A celebration of her life will be announced at a later date. Arrangements are by the Kevin B. Comeau Funeral Home, 486 Main Street, Haverhill.
